SMALL LUXURY HOTELS: CONTENT STRATEGY


🧭 Context & Challenge
Collaborating with Small Luxury Hotels, a prestigious collection of boutique properties, we set out to develop a cohesive and impactful communications strategy that would elevate their brand presence globally.
The key challenges were:
Creating a unified voice across multiple properties in Europe and Southeast Asia.
Designing a content strategy adaptable across both online and offline channels.
Enhancing brand engagement in competitive luxury hospitality markets.
🚀 My Role & Contributions
As Project Director collaborating with Hermana Creatives, I spearheaded the strategy and creative direction for Small Luxury Hotels. My contributions included:
Content Strategy Development: Designed and implemented a communications strategy starting with social media and expanding to other digital and offline platforms.
Collaborative Creative Direction: Led the creative direction of content production in close collaboration with SLH’s in-house team and photographers, ensuring brand-aligned storytelling.
Social Media Management: Oversaw content creation and curation for SLH properties in Europe and Southeast Asia, ensuring regional relevance and engagement.
Brand Cohesion: Developed guidelines to unify messaging, tone, and visual identity across multiple hotel properties.
📊 Results & Impact
Cohesive Brand Presence: Achieved a unified voice and aesthetic across SLH’s digital platforms.
Collaborative Creative Output: Delivered high-quality, engaging content by coordinating closely with SLH and their photographers.
Enhanced Engagement: Increased brand interaction and visibility across key markets.
Scalable Framework: Created a flexible content model adaptable to diverse hotels and regions for long-term brand growth.
